yhkn.net
当前位置:首页 >> C语言iF语句的嵌套实例 >>

C语言iF语句的嵌套实例

if while for do while 都可以嵌套 // lz98.cpp : 定义控制台应用程序的入口点.//#include "stdafx.h"#include <stdio.h>#include <math.h>#include "string.h"#define Q 2#define W 5#define RH 2#define RHCJ 5 void main() { char b[15],c[15],d[15]

if(m%i==0) return 0;如果有m%i==0成立,那么返回0.返回0表示直接退出当前函数,并返回0给调用函数.

if(x>=0) { if(x<10) {Y=(double)sin((double)x);printf("Y=%f",Y);} else if(x<20) { } esle if(x<30) { } else if(x<40) { } } 里面很多我就不写了,只是要记得在if和else if和else以后加用大括号括起来,从开始要养成好的代码习惯从加大括号开始 求采纳,求经验,求悬赏 自己写的不容易

if是最简单的语句了 多看看例子 记住else跟if是就近配对就行了

#include <stdio.h> void main() { int number; printf("请输入一个对应的整数(0~6): "); scanf("%d",&number); if(number==0) printf("星期天\n"); else if(number==1) printf("星期一\n"); else if(number==2) printf("星期二\n"); else if

你到底是对if中的条件不懂还是else if不明白呀.这个if中的条件是逗号运算符.逗号运算符的规则可以在书上找到,我不想讲.如果是else if的话可以给你说一下.if的格式是这样的 if(){} //首先判断这个if,若满足就执行后面的语句,然后就

iint i=0;if(i1) {printf("i=%d\n",i); i++; } printf("i=%d\n",i);}

// llz2.cpp : 定义控制台应用程序的入口点.//#include "stdafx.h"#include &lt;stdio.h&gt;#include &lt;math.h&gt;#include "string.h"void main() { char a='a',b;printf("%c",++a); printf("%c\n",b=a++);}// llz2.cpp : 定义控制台应用程序的入口点

一般来说,if 有如下几种形式:if-else if-else if……else;if-else;if if嵌套就是在上列的if形式下相互扦插.比如if-if-else-else这个嵌套我给你解释下,第一if对的else是最后一个else,第二个if 对的else是第一个else,看出是什么样的形式没有???就是中间对应的if-else就是嵌套在第一个if和最后一个else中,这就是嵌套.一般来说,最后一个if所对应的else是和它离得最近的那个. 不知道你是否看懂了,希望能帮助你.

三、if--else if--else结构. if(表达式1) 语句1; else if(表达式2) 语句2; else if(表达式3) 语句3; . . . else 语句n; 这种结构是从上到下逐个对条件进行判断,一旦发现条件满点足就执行与它有关的语句, 并跳过其它剩余阶梯;若没有一个条件

网站首页 | 网站地图
All rights reserved Powered by www.yhkn.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com